正邦的网站建设南昌谁做网站设计

张小明 2026/1/19 20:31:41
正邦的网站建设,南昌谁做网站设计,加盟网站模板,网页设计流行趋势文章目录 一、React、Vue、Angular简介二、React初始化案例三、Vue初始化案例四、Angular初始化案例五、相关链接 一、React、Vue、Angular简介 前端三大主流框架分别是Angular、React和Vue。以下是这三个框架的详细概述#xff1a; Angular#xff1a; Angular原名Angu…文章目录一、React、Vue、Angular简介二、React初始化案例三、Vue初始化案例四、Angular初始化案例五、相关链接一、React、Vue、Angular简介前端三大主流框架分别是Angular、React和Vue。以下是这三个框架的详细概述AngularAngular原名AngularJS诞生于2009年由Google开发并维护。它是一个完整的框架提供了数据绑定、组件化、路由、依赖注入等功能。Angular采用了TypeScript作为开发语言它是JavaScript的一个超集提供了静态类型检查和更强大的面向对象编程能力。Angular的特点包括功能强大、完整且稳定适用于开发大型和复杂的Web应用。它提供了很多内置的功能和工具如模板语法、表单验证、HTTP模块等帮助开发者更快速地构建高质量的Web应用。Angular支持移动端开发可以使用Ionic等工具将Web应用打包成原生应用。ReactReact是由Facebook开发并开源的一个JavaScript库正式版推出于2013年。它专注于构建用户界面并以其虚拟文档对象模型Virtual DOM和高效的diff算法而闻名。React的组件化开发模式允许开发者将UI和业务逻辑分离提高代码的复用性和可维护性。React对新开发人员来说较为友好并提供了JSX语法这是一种混合HTML和JavaScript的语言使编写React组件更加容易和直观。React的社区支持庞大可以找到大量的文档、教程和工具来帮助开发者解决问题。VueVue是一个由华人开发者尤雨溪创造的前端框架正式推出于2014年。Vue借鉴了Angular和React的特点如Virtual DOM、双向数据绑定、diff算法、响应式属性、组件化开发等并进行了相关优化使其使用更加方便和容易上手。Vue以其简洁易用和高效的特点而受到开发者的喜爱尤其适合初学者。Vue也支持组件化开发允许开发者将UI和业务逻辑分离提高代码的可复用性和可维护性。二、React初始化案例React详细介绍React是一个用于构建用户界面的JavaScript库它起源于Facebook的内部项目。React的出现是因为Facebook对市场上所有JavaScript MVC框架都不满意决定自行开发一套用于架设Instagram的网站并于2013年5月开源。React主要用于构建UI可以在React里传递多种类型的参数如声明代码帮助开发者渲染出UI也可以是静态的HTML DOM元素也可以传递动态变量甚至是可交互的应用组件。React的特点包括声明式设计React使创建交互式UI变得轻而易举。为应用的每一个状态设计简洁的视图当数据变动时React能高效更新并渲染合适的组件。组件化构建管理自身状态的封装组件然后对其组合以构成复杂的UI。高效React通过对DOM的模拟最大限度地减少与DOM的交互。灵活无论使用什么技术栈React都可以方便地引入开发新功能而无需重写现有代码。React案例代码Hello World示例代码这是一个简单的React组件示例用于显示“Hello, World!”文本。import React from react; import ReactDOM from react-dom; class HelloWorld extends React.Component { render() { return h1Hello, World!/h1; } } ReactDOM.render(HelloWorld /, document.getElementById(root));这段代码通过React的ReactDOM.render方法将HelloWorld /组件渲染到div idroot/div元素中。组件的render方法返回一个包含h1标签的JSX表达式。State和Props示例代码这个示例展示了如何在React组件中使用状态和属性state and props。import React from react; import ReactDOM from react-dom; class Counter extends React.Component { constructor(props) { super(props); this.state { count: 0 }; } increment() { this.setState({ count: this.state.count 1 }); } render() { return ( div pCount: {this.state.count}/p button onClick{() this.increment()}Increment/button /div ); } } ReactDOM.render(Counter /, document.getElementById(root));在这个示例中我们创建了一个名为Counter的React组件。该组件具有一个状态count并通过increment方法增加计数。在组件的render方法中我们显示当前计数并提供一个按钮来增加计数。当用户点击按钮时会调用increment方法并更新状态从而触发组件的重新渲染并显示更新后的计数。三、Vue初始化案例Vue.js 详细介绍Vue.js 是一款构建用户界面的渐进式框架。与其他大型框架不同的是Vue 被设计为可以自底向上逐层应用。Vue 的核心库只关注视图层不仅易于上手还便于与第三方库或已有项目整合。另一方面当与现代化的工具链以及各种支持类库结合使用时Vue 也能为复杂的单页应用SPA提供驱动。Vue.js 的主要特点包括组件化Vue 允许你以可复用的方式构建大型应用。在 Vue 中一个组件本质上是一个拥有预定义选项的一个 Vue 实例。响应式数据绑定Vue 的核心库只关注视图层它采用简洁的模板语法将 DOM 操作与数据操作进行绑定使得数据变化时视图能够自动更新。指令Vue 提供了一系列内建的指令如v-if、v-for、v-bind等这些指令为模板提供了强大的功能。计算属性和侦听器Vue 提供了计算属性和侦听器用于处理复杂逻辑和响应数据变化。可定制的过渡和动画Vue 在插入、更新或移除 DOM 时提供多种过渡效果。路由和状态管理Vue 可以与 Vue Router 和 Vuex 这样的库一起使用以构建复杂的单页应用。轻量级和灵活性Vue 相对于其他大型框架如 Angular 或 React来说更轻量级这使得它更加灵活和易于使用。Vue.js 案例代码以下是一个简单的 Vue.js 示例它展示了如何使用 Vue 创建一个计数器!DOCTYPE html html langen head meta charsetUTF-8 meta nameviewport contentwidthdevice-width, initial-scale1.0 titleVue.js Counter Example/title script srchttps://cdn.jsdelivr.net/npm/vue2.6.14/dist/vue.js/script /head body div idapp p{{ message }}/p button clickincrementIncrement/button pCount: {{ count }}/p /div script new Vue({ el: #app, data: { message: Hello Vue!, count: 0 }, methods: { increment: function() { this.count; } } }); /script /body /html在这个示例中我们创建了一个新的 Vue 实例并将其挂载到 id 为app的元素上。在 Vue 实例的data对象中我们定义了message和count两个响应式数据属性。我们还定义了一个名为increment的方法该方法会在每次点击按钮时被调用并使count的值递增。在模板中我们使用双大括号插值来显示message和count的值并使用click指令来监听按钮的点击事件。四、Angular初始化案例Angular 详细介绍Angular 是一个由 Google 开发和维护的开源前端框架用于构建单页应用SPA和跨平台应用。Angular 提供了一个结构化的开发框架它整合了多种技术包括 TypeScript、HTML、CSS 和其他库以简化应用程序的开发过程。Angular 强调组件化、模块化、依赖注入和响应式编程等核心概念。Angular 的主要特点包括组件化Angular 应用是由一系列组件组成的每个组件控制屏幕上的一小块区域。组件是 Angular 应用的构建块它们封装了相关的 HTML、CSS 和 TypeScript 代码。TypeScript 支持Angular 使用 TypeScript 作为主要开发语言它提供了静态类型检查、面向对象编程特性和 ES6 功能。双向数据绑定Angular 提供了强大的数据绑定功能可以自动更新视图以反映模型中的更改并在模型更改时自动更新视图。依赖注入Angular 使用依赖注入DI来管理组件之间的依赖关系使得代码更易于测试和维护。路由Angular 提供了强大的路由功能允许你定义不同的视图和它们之间的导航路径。表单验证Angular 提供了丰富的表单验证功能支持模板驱动表单和响应式表单。指令和管道Angular 提供了许多内建的指令和管道用于在模板中执行复杂的操作和数据转换。模块化Angular 应用被组织成模块每个模块包含了一组相关的组件、服务和指令。Angular 案例代码以下是一个简单的 Angular 示例它展示了如何创建一个计数器组件首先你需要确保你的项目已经通过 Angular CLI 创建并设置好了。如果你还没有创建项目可以使用以下命令创建一个新的 Angular 项目ng new my-angular-app cd my-angular-app然后你可以创建一个新的计数器组件ng generate component counter接下来编辑counter组件的 TypeScript 文件counter.component.ts和 HTML 模板文件counter.component.html。counter.component.ts:import { Component } from angular/core; Component({ selector: app-counter, templateUrl: ./counter.component.html, styleUrls: [./counter.component.css] }) export class CounterComponent { count 0; increment() { this.count; } decrement() { this.count--; } }counter.component.html:pCount: {{ count }}/p button (click)increment()Increment/button button (click)decrement()Decrement/button在app.module.ts中确保你已经将CounterComponent添加到declarations数组中import { NgModule } from angular/core; import { BrowserModule } from angular/platform-browser; import { AppComponent } from ./app.component; import { CounterComponent } from ./counter/counter.component; NgModule({ declarations: [ AppComponent, CounterComponent ], imports: [ BrowserModule ], providers: [], bootstrap: [AppComponent] }) export class AppModule { }最后在app.component.html中使用app-counter选择器来包含你的计数器组件app-counter/app-counter现在当你运行你的 Angular 应用时例如使用ng serve命令你应该能在浏览器中看到一个计数器其中包含两个按钮一个用于增加计数另一个用于减少计数。五、相关链接Vue3官方地址Vue3中文文档「Vue3系列」Vue3简介及安装「Vue3系列」Vue3起步/创建项目「Vue3系列」Vue3指令「Vue3系列」Vue3 模板语法「Vue3系列」Vue3 条件语句/循环语句「Vue3系列」Vue3 组件「Vue3系列」Vue3 计算属性computed、监听属性watch「Vue3系列」Vue3 样式绑定「Vue3系列」Vue3 事件处理「vue3系列」Vue3 表单2025开年AI技术打得火热正在改变前端人的职业命运阿里云核心业务全部接入Agent体系字节跳动30%前端岗位要求大模型开发能力腾讯、京东、百度开放招聘技术岗80%与AI相关……大模型正在重构技术开发范式传统CRUD开发模式正在被AI原生应用取代最残忍的是业务面临转型领导要求用RAG优化知识库检索你不会带AI团队微调大模型要准备多少数据你不懂想转型大模型应用开发工程师等相关岗没项目实操经验……这不是技术焦虑而是职业生存危机曾经React、Vue等热门的开发框架已不再是就业的金钥匙。如果认为会调用API就是懂大模型、能进行二次开发那就大错特错了。制造、医疗、金融等各行业都在加速AI应用落地未来企业更看重能用AI大模型技术重构业务流的技术人。如今技术圈降薪裁员频频爆发传统岗位大批缩水相反AI相关技术岗疯狂扩招薪资逆势上涨150%大厂老板们甚至开出70-100W年薪挖掘AI大模型人才不出1年 “有AI项目开发经验”或将成为前端人投递简历的门槛。风口之下与其像“温水煮青蛙”一样坐等被行业淘汰不如先人一步掌握AI大模型原理应用技术项目实操经验“顺风”翻盘大模型目前在人工智能领域可以说正处于一种“炙手可热”的状态吸引了很多人的关注和兴趣也有很多新人小白想要学习入门大模型那么如何入门大模型呢下面给大家分享一份2025最新版的大模型学习路线帮助新人小白更系统、更快速的学习大模型2025最新版CSDN大礼包《AGI大模型学习资源包》免费分享**一、2025最新大模型学习路线一个明确的学习路线可以帮助新人了解从哪里开始按照什么顺序学习以及需要掌握哪些知识点。大模型领域涉及的知识点非常广泛没有明确的学习路线可能会导致新人感到迷茫不知道应该专注于哪些内容。我们把学习路线分成L1到L4四个阶段一步步带你从入门到进阶从理论到实战。L1级别:AI大模型时代的华丽登场L1阶段我们会去了解大模型的基础知识以及大模型在各个行业的应用和分析学习理解大模型的核心原理关键技术以及大模型应用场景通过理论原理结合多个项目实战从提示工程基础到提示工程进阶掌握Prompt提示工程。L2级别AI大模型RAG应用开发工程L2阶段是我们的AI大模型RAG应用开发工程我们会去学习RAG检索增强生成包括Naive RAG、Advanced-RAG以及RAG性能评估还有GraphRAG在内的多个RAG热门项目的分析。L3级别大模型Agent应用架构进阶实践L3阶段大模型Agent应用架构进阶实现我们会去学习LangChain、 LIamaIndex框架也会学习到AutoGPT、 MetaGPT等多Agent系统打造我们自己的Agent智能体同时还可以学习到包括Coze、Dify在内的可视化工具的使用。L4级别大模型微调与私有化部署L4阶段大模型的微调和私有化部署我们会更加深入的探讨Transformer架构学习大模型的微调技术利用DeepSpeed、Lamam Factory等工具快速进行模型微调并通过Ollama、vLLM等推理部署框架实现模型的快速部署。整个大模型学习路线L1主要是对大模型的理论基础、生态以及提示词他的一个学习掌握而L3 L4更多的是通过项目实战来掌握大模型的应用开发针对以上大模型的学习路线我们也整理了对应的学习视频教程和配套的学习资料。二、大模型经典PDF书籍书籍和学习文档资料是学习大模型过程中必不可少的我们精选了一系列深入探讨大模型技术的书籍和学习文档它们由领域内的顶尖专家撰写内容全面、深入、详尽为你学习大模型提供坚实的理论基础。书籍含电子版PDF三、大模型视频教程对于很多自学或者没有基础的同学来说书籍这些纯文字类的学习教材会觉得比较晦涩难以理解因此我们提供了丰富的大模型视频教程以动态、形象的方式展示技术概念帮助你更快、更轻松地掌握核心知识。四、大模型项目实战学以致用当你的理论知识积累到一定程度就需要通过项目实战在实际操作中检验和巩固你所学到的知识同时为你找工作和职业发展打下坚实的基础。五、大模型面试题面试不仅是技术的较量更需要充分的准备。在你已经掌握了大模型技术之后就需要开始准备面试我们将提供精心整理的大模型面试题库涵盖当前面试中可能遇到的各种技术问题让你在面试中游刃有余。因篇幅有限仅展示部分资料需要点击下方链接即可前往获取2025最新版CSDN大礼包《AGI大模型学习资源包》免费分享
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

模板网站 知乎做外贸免费的网站有哪些

字节跳动UI-TARS:革新GUI交互的AI原生代理 【免费下载链接】UI-TARS-2B-SFT 项目地址: https://ai.gitcode.com/hf_mirrors/ByteDance-Seed/UI-TARS-2B-SFT 导语:字节跳动推出全新AI原生代理模型UI-TARS,以端到端单一视觉语言模型架构…

张小明 2026/1/17 17:16:44 网站建设

人才网站运营建设 材料使用django做网站

Keil5安装在工业控制中的应用:从零搭建稳定开发环境(实战指南) 一个“简单”的安装,为何卡住整个项目? 你有没有遇到过这样的场景: 新买的开发板接上电脑,Keil点下载却提示“Cannot access t…

张小明 2026/1/17 17:16:44 网站建设

长沙网站设计优秀柚v米科技校园门户网站建设方案

使用TensorRT-LLM优化LLM推理性能 在当前大模型落地浪潮中,一个残酷的现实是:训练完成只是起点,推理效率才决定生死。我们见过太多项目卡在“能跑”和“可用”之间——PyTorch里流畅生成的Demo,一上线就因延迟飙升、吞吐不足而被迫…

张小明 2026/1/17 17:16:45 网站建设

廊坊市网站推广wordpress用户定期清理

本文将多次使用C语言中的scanf与getchar函数&#xff0c;带你充分理解输入缓冲区。#define _CRT_SECURE_NO_WARNINGS #include <stdio.h> int main() {/*int chgetchar();//从输入缓冲区获取一个字符&#xff0c;返回值类型是int//错误输入时返回EOF&#xff08;end of …

张小明 2026/1/17 17:16:45 网站建设

惠州做棋牌网站建设多少钱怎么进入外网

摘要 随着互联网技术的快速发展和人们生活水平的提高&#xff0c;宠物行业迎来了前所未有的发展机遇。宠物不再仅仅是家庭中的陪伴者&#xff0c;更成为了许多人生活中不可或缺的一部分。宠物用品的需求也随之增长&#xff0c;传统的线下宠物商店已经无法满足现代消费者的便捷性…

张小明 2026/1/19 3:28:07 网站建设

怎么建设自己的卡盟网站江苏自助建站平台

C# 枚举、特性与委托的深度解析 1. 枚举(Enums) 1.1 初始化 在 C# 中,枚举成员的初始化有其默认规则和自定义方式。默认情况下,第一个枚举成员的值设为 0,后续成员的值依次递增: enum Values {A,B,C,D }在这个例子中, A 的值为 0, B 为 1, C 为 2, D 为…

张小明 2026/1/19 3:28:05 网站建设